that rear O2 has ZERO affect on the air/fuel mixture, it is only there to test if the cat is working correctly, which is why it throws a code when the cat is missing....
FYI it is VERY bad to run lean, especially if it's very lean

Exactly right - the rear 02 part of OBDII. And remember, just becuase your ecu is trying to lean you out does not mean you are running lean
It just means it thinks you are running too rich!
